Tokyo City Atlas from the Japanese publishers Kodansha covering the central areas at scales varying from 1:6, 500 to 1:8, 000, the city’s 23 Ku wards at 1:28, 000, plus selected other areas including Yokohama, Kawasaki, etc. All place names: streets, districts, places of interest, etc, are in both Japanese & Latin alphabet, with English names of institutions, businesses, etc. Subway & railway lines are shown with names; subway stations as well underground arcades are also annotated with entrance names or numbers. Expressways show exits/entrances & other main traffic arteries are indicated. For identification of addresses, both block & chome numbers are shown; with chome, town, ward & prefectural boundaries are clearly marked. On the more detailed coverage of central Tokyo numerous buildings, institutions, hotels, department stores & shops, educational establishments, temples, etc. are named (in English). The less detailed maps covering the 23 Ku wards highlight selected places of interest. Additional pages cover the Kawasaki – Yokohama areas with enlargements for central areas, plus Yokota, Zama & Yokosuka. Extensive index lists not only streets & districts, but also other place names shown on the maps, with separate lists of airlines, embassies, & hotels or inns. Also provided is a diagram of the whole Metropolitan Tokyo rail system. Map legend, names of institutions & all explanatory text include English. ...

Stanfords was established in 1853 and opened their iconic Covent Garden flagship store in 1901. They have become the top retailer of maps, travel books and accessories in the UK and arguably offer the largest selection of maps and travel books worldwide. Famous names such as Captain Robert Falcon Scott, Ranulph Fiennes and Michael Palin have purchased from Stanfords. They now have a shop in Bristol and both stores together with other venues operate a calendar of events including talks, book signings and exhibitions. As a specialist map retailer, the map selection is comprehensive and includes road maps, street maps and walking maps from worldwide destinations, as well as a selection of world atlases and wall maps. Books include travel guides and travel literature. Stanfords also stock globes, from miniatures made of blue marble to magnificent floor-standing globes.
